Winding up of Tata Floating Rate Fund Long Term Plan

Tata Mutual fund has decided to wind up Tata Floating Rate Fund Long Term Plan as the scheme is not able to maintain the average minimum Assets Under Management (AUM) criteria of ₹20 Crores.

The Fund House has also decided to wind up Tata Fixed Income Portfolio Fund - Scheme A3, Scheme B2, Scheme B3, Scheme C2, and Scheme C3 because of the same reason.
